This endorsement addresses procedural matters in an appeal from a partial summary judgment.
The respondent argued the order under appeal was interlocutory, requiring leave to appeal.
The court set a schedule for submissions on whether the order is interlocutory or final, and for an expedited appeal hearing.
It noted that a motion to stay was likely moot as the tenant had already been evicted, preferring to expedite the appeal.
The judge also raised a potential jurisdictional concern regarding the Court of Appeal's jurisdiction over the appeal.
